Washington County Help Me Grow
Washington County Help Me Grow is a program for expectant parents, newborns, infants and toddlers that provides health, parenting skills and developmental services so children start school healthy and ready to learn.

Have you heard about Sparkler? It is a free mobile app for families with children 0-5 and programs serving those families, available in English and Spanish, for iOS and Android. Sparkler offers the mobile Ages & Stages Questionnaires® (ASQ®). ASQs provide reliable, accurate developmental and social-emotional screening for children between 1 month and age 6.
